Let’s cut straight to the chase: There is no official, native Android port of Rise of the Tomb Raider.
Square Enix has released several Tomb Raider titles on the Google Play Store (specifically Tomb Raider I, II, and Reloaded), but Rise—the second installment in the Survivor trilogy—was never ported to mobile. The hardware requirements for the game’s engine (which utilizes advanced lighting, physics, and large asset streaming) were simply too high for the average Android phone at the time of its release.
If you see a website claiming to offer a direct APK file (e.g., Rise.Of.Tomb.Raider.Android.apk) typically sized between 1GB and 3GB, it is a fake.

Since there is no native app for this specific sequel, users typically use PC Emulators to run the Windows version on high-end Android hardware.
Emulation Software: Apps like GameHub (Gamefusion) or Winlator are commonly used to create a virtual PC environment on Android.
Hardware Requirements: To run a heavy PC title like Rise of the Tomb Raider, you generally need a device with a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 or newer and at least 8GB to 12GB of RAM.
Process: You must own the PC version of the game, transfer the game files to your device, and configure the emulator (often using tools like DirectX11 and Proton) to launch the executable file. Future Outlook
